Bed and sofa bed were very comfortable, we had no problem with it or anything about the room. It would be better if the brightness of the TV was adjustable. ( I like to fall asleep with the TV on, watching the navigational channel feels better in the open sea but no problem with the TV off while sleeping)
just in case someone is wondering how the sofa bed set up is like...
The nightlight in the bathroom is a genius, thoughtful idea, the nightlight is bright enough for me to do everything in the bathroom.
Kettle was clean, we used the kettle a lot. It always feels good to have a cup of hot tea on a chilly day, enjoying the balcony and ( watch the world go by?)
picture below is cabin on Deck 9 room 604 starboard side, bed by the balcony set up
view looking forward and the aft of the ship
( lifeboats and the design of the hull blocked the view from looking down to the ocean, the cabin was very comfortable nonetheless)
Tips and tricks that I learned from this board...The table in the cabin is movable.
I will only book a balcony cabin on this class of ship if there is a chance of another cruise on her...I really love the design( color, decor) and the lay out of balcony cabin. No complaint at all.

We were hanging around on the roof top garden. Until 11:30, we decided to wait in line for the shuttle back to Kwun Tong.
As we were waiting in line, a staff came and told us that the next shuttle should be there in an hour, she ( the staff) suggested that we can take the bus to Kwun Tong (route 5R) alternatively...
I thought that we were not allow to carry our big, heavy luggage onto the bus.(most of the bus/ double decker not allow passenger to carry luggage except buses go to the airport)
The staff said a lot of passenger were carrying luggage when she was on the bus(5R) to the pier so we should be ok if we want to take the bus.
At 12:00 we boarded the bus to Kwun Tong, took the MTR back home.

I believe it was the head of Taichung Tourism and Travel Bureau( Chen Sheng Shan) , The CEO of the chartered travel agent (Leung Kong Lan) and the Captain(Henrik Loy) ( from left to right)
There was not much to be missed...just some plaque exchange. We missed the welcome dancing in all of the port because the ship docked at starboard side:(...(and we were still in bed probably)
Not sure if there was a firework show in Hualien before leaving the dock, I saw some after firework smokes/clouds in the air and regret not watching it..
just a random note...
According to a press release from the tourism bureau of Taichung, there were 34 cruise ship visited Taichung in 2015, 5 in 2016, 2 in 2017. The government is doing everything to attract more international cruise ships visiting Taichung but it is very hard to boost that number for other reasons..... no international cruise ship will be visiting Taichung so far according to cruisetimetables ...

The next cruise specialist is right. As far as I know, This cruise can only be book with a travel agency in Hong Kong until about 2-3months before departure date, another 2-3 competitor travel agency join in selling this cruise.

It was 15:20, about a hundred of passengers and crew members were waiting in line for the shuttle back to the pier. There should be a shuttle depart at 15:15 but no visual of the shuttle.
At 15:30?(not sure), There should be another shuttle come to pick up passenger but no visual of the shuttle, no staff, no sign.
Panic kicks in as the time ticking( traffic was bad, I heard that it was very hard to get a taxi in this area)
I started to walk around and spotted the shuttle that was supposed to depart at 15:15 was waiting for us on the other side....and the shuttle was 80% full..
anyway we boarded the shuttle and back to the ship on time( We stuck in traffic for about 15 mins. It was Sunday so everybody was out on the road so the traffic was really bad)

There should be a pool lift on the star's main pool. The pool lift is removable. ( I saw some engineers working/ testing/ installing the pool lift in Feb/Mar 2017)
I guess you can ask the crew if you need it to get into the pool.
Not sure about other ncl ship though...
